- (1) School-based health services must be provided and documented by SBHS-recognized providers that provide services within their scope of practice and in compliance with their respective board rules and requirements.
(2) Providers with the following qualifications are recognized by the Authority’s SBHS program to provide Medicaid-covered services in education settings:
- (a) A licensed audiologist providing and documenting services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Oregon Board of Examiners for Speech-Language Pathology and Audiology’s OARs Chapter 335;
- (b) A licensed psychiatrist providing and documenting services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Oregon’s Medical Practice Act and the Oregon Medical Board’s OARs Chapter 847.
- (c) A licensed psychologist providing and documenting services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Board of Psychology’s OARs Chapter 858.
- (d) A psychologist associate, practicing under the supervision of a licensed psychologist or with authority to function without immediate supervision, and providing and documenting services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Board of Psychology’s OARs Chapter 858.
- (e) A psychology technician, performing allowable services under the supervision of a psychologist, and providing and documenting services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Board of Psychology’s OARs Chapter 858.
- (f) A Licensed Professional Counselor (LPC) providing and documenting services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Board of Licensed Professional Counselors and Therapists’ OARs Chapter 833.
- (g) A Licensed Professional Counselor Associate (LPCA), performing allowable services under the supervision of an LPC, and providing and documenting services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Board of Licensed Professional Counselors and Therapists’ OARs Chapter 833.
- (h) A Licensed Marriage and Family Therapist (LMFT) providing and documenting services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Board of Licensed Professional Counselors and Therapists’ OARs Chapter 833.
- (i) A Licensed Marriage and Family Therapist Associate (LMFTA), performing allowable services under the supervision of an LMFT, and providing and documenting services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Board of Licensed Professional Counselors and Therapists’ OARs Chapter 833.
- (j) A Licensed Clinical Social Worker (LCSW) providing and documenting services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Board of Licensed Social Workers’ OARs Chapter 877.
- (k) A Clinical Social Work Associate (CSWA), holding an unrestricted certificate and practicing under an approved plan of practice and supervision with a LCSW, and providing and documenting services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Board of Licensed Social Workers’ OARs Chapter 877.
- (l) A TSPC-licensed School Psychologist providing services within their scope of practice in compliance with OAR Chapter 584, Division 245 and National Association of School Psychologists (NASP) professional standards and documenting services in compliance with NASP professional standards and OAR Chapter 584, Division 245 and OAR 410-120-1360.
- (m) A school psychologist intern or practicum student, practicing under the supervision of a TSPC-licensed School Psychologist providing services within their scope of practice in compliance with OAR Chapter 584, Division 245 and NASP professional standards and documenting services in compliance with NASP professional standards and OAR Chapter 584, Division 245 and OAR 410-120-1360.
- (n) A TSPC-licensed School Social Worker providing services within their scope of practice in compliance with OAR Chapter 584, Division 245 and National Association of Social Workers (NASW) Practice Standards for School Social Workers and documenting services in compliance with NASW Practice Standards for School Social Workers and OAR Chapter 584, Division 245 and OAR 410-120-1360.
- (o) A TSPC-licensed School Counselor providing services within their scope of practice in compliance with OAR Chapter 584, Division 245 and American School Counselor Association (ASCA) standards and documenting services in compliance with ASCA standards and OAR Chapter 584, Division 245 and OAR 410-120-1360.
- (p) A licensed dentist providing and documenting services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Oregon Board of Dentistry’s OARs Chapter 818, Oregon Dental Practice Act.
- (q) An expanded practice dental hygienist, practicing under the general supervision of a licensed dentist, and providing and documenting services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Oregon Board of Dentistry’s OARs Chapter 818, Oregon Dental Practice Act.
- (r) A licensed dental therapist, practicing dental therapy under the supervision of a dentist and pursuant to a collaborative agreement with the dentist, and providing and documenting services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Oregon Board of Dentistry’s OARs Chapter 818, Oregon Dental Practice Act.
- (s) A Nurse Practitioner (NP) providing and documenting services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Oregon State Board of Nursing’s OARs Chapter 851, Oregon Nurse Practice Act.
- (t) A Registered Nurse (RN) providing and documenting services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Oregon State Board of Nursing’s OARs Chapter 851, Oregon Nurse Practice Act.
- (u) A Licensed Practical Nurse (LPN), practicing under the clinical direction of a RN, NP, or physician who meets the standards of licensing or certification for the health service provided, and providing and documenting services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Oregon State Board of Nursing’s OARs Chapter 851, Oregon Nurse Practice Act.
- (v) An Unregulated Assistive Person (UAP) performing a specific nursing task that has been delegated to the UAP by a RN or NP. The delegating nurse retains accountability for the nursing procedure and must document services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Oregon State Board of Nursing’s OARs Chapter 851, Oregon Nurse Practice Act.
- (w) A licensed dietician providing and documenting services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Oregon Board of Licensed Dieticians’ OARs Chapter 834.
- (x) A licensed Occupational Therapist (OT) providing and documenting services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Oregon Occupational Therapy Licensing Board OARs Chapter 339, Occupational Therapy Practice Act.
- (y) A Certified Occupational Therapist Assistant (COTA), providing occupational therapy treatment under the supervision of a licensed occupational therapist, and providing and documenting services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Oregon Occupational Therapy Licensing Board OARs Chapter 339, Occupational Therapy Practice Act.
(z) A licensed Physical Therapist (PT) providing and documenting services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Oregon Board of Physical Therapy OARs Chapter 848.
(aa) A licensed Physical Therapist Assistant (PTA), providing physical therapy treatment under the supervision of a licensed physical therapist, and providing and documenting services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Oregon Board of Physical Therapy OARs Chapter 848.
(bb) A Medical Doctor (MD) providing and documenting services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Oregon’s Medical Practice Act and the Oregon Medical Board’s OARs Chapter 847.
- (cc) A Doctor of Osteopathic Medicine (DO) providing and documenting services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Oregon’s Medical Practice Act and the Oregon Medical Board’s OARs Chapter 847.
(dd) A Doctor of Podiatric Medicine (DPM) providing and documenting services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Oregon’s Medical Practice Act and the Oregon Medical Board’s OARs Chapter 847.
(ee) A Physician Assistant (PA), practicing under a written collaboration agreement signed by a physician, and providing and documenting services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Oregon’s Medical Practice Act and the Oregon Medical Board’s OARs Chapter 847.
(ff) A licensed Speech-Language Pathologist (SLP) providing and documenting services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Oregon Board of Examiners for Speech-Language Pathology and Audiology’s OARs Chapter 335.
(gg) An educator licensed and endorsed, prior to July 1, 2016, by the Teacher Standards and Practice Commission (TSPC) with a Communication Disorder endorsement (speech language pathology), exempted in ORS 681.230(4) pursuant to SB287, who meets the following requirements:
- (A) Holds a Certificate of Clinical Competency (CCC) from the American Speech and Hearing Association (ASHA); or
- (B) Has completed the equivalent educational requirements and work experience necessary for the certificate; or
- (C) Has completed the academic program and is acquiring supervised work experience to qualify for the certificate; or
(D) Is authorized to administer speech therapy to an individual when the individual is a child or young adult eligible for special education, as defined by state or federal law, receiving speech therapy services pursuant to an Individualized Education Program (IEP) or Individualized Family Service Plan (IFSP).
(hh) A speech-language pathologist in their Clinical Fellowship Year (CFY), practicing under the supervision of a licensed speech-language pathologist, and providing and documenting services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Oregon Board of Examiners for Speech-Language Pathology and Audiology’s OARs Chapter 335.
- (ii) A licensed Speech-Language Pathology Assistant (SLPA), practicing under the supervision of a licensed speech-language pathologist, and providing and documenting services within their scope of practice and in compliance with Oregon Board of Examiners for Speech-Language Pathology and Audiology’s OARs Chapter 335.
